Main objectives

Within 5 months: - to gain insights about which kind of participation we might expect and leverage on (both online and offline) - to gain insights in order to give a direction for the development of the technical platform

One of the previous case studies - and lessons learnedLa Memoria al Tempo di Internet - 22nd of October We tried to involve students in: • discussion on "what is a memory?“

• sharing of personal memories

• collectively build the memory of the event• during the day: through a couple of diaries where students could write their comments and an online blog• by uploading photos on flickr with the tag "livememories"

but... no participation! (this is good, we are needed! ;) 4

1. Opera for the future Opera Universitaria and Portobeseno already started a collective construction of the memory of the birth of the new students residence San Bartolomeo through:- photos- videos- audio interviewsWe could continue with the collaboration of Portobeseno and of the Cooperativa Mercurio (they have a web radio we could leverage on within the residence)pro: active, young, “connected” users, “social networks”, easy mashup, tied to real-world locations and contactscons: tools: webradio platform, upload of files on Flickr, ...content: photos, audio and video files, textstarget: university studentsresources: low resources demandingprobability of success: 20%

2. TrentoAsa communityTrentoAsa is an active community of photographs on Flickr (trentoasa.it, www.flickr.com/groups/trento_asa 127 members) We could exploit some material from the Historical Museum of Trento (possibility to use the museum's archive of photos given by citizens) We could set a photo contest about the memory of particular places (how they were and how they are) and engage/monitor the discussion within the communitypro: already online, motivated, tech-savvy, easy mashupcons: engagement must be very cooltools: Flickr content: photos, maybe some textstarget: Flickr usersresources: low resources demandingprobability of success: 12% 7

4. Family TreeThe Archivio Diocesano has a big database containing names of people who left the Trentino region in the XIX century. On the 22nd of October they said they wanted to put online this archive anyway, to help people who asked to find their forefathers. How to exploit this archive to engage a discussion on it? How could we involve citizens somehow? pro: data should be online anyway (to be verified)cons: privacy issues, will data be online?tools: content: name and what?target: every citizen (especially people with expats)probability of success: ??% 9

6. MIT and Zambana Vecchia

http://mobile.mit.edu/en/zambanaMIT and FBK joint project To investigate how to transform the village of Zambana into a Sustainable Green Village (creatively redesign the village of Zambana, from an urban planning perspective, as well as from architectural and new media design perspectives).  Collect the memory of what Zambana was (landslide) and what is becoming ... Pro: MIT does it anyway, physical worldCons: not straightforwardtools: voice interviews and photos?content: text, photos, voice, video?target: inhabitants of Zambana (past, present, future)probability of success: ~4%
